International cargo transportation insurance is an insurance policy that covers various goods during the transportation of foreign trade goods. There are various ways to transport foreign trade goods, including sea, land, air, and postal delivery. The types of international cargo transportation insurance are divided into four categories based on the type of transportation vehicle they cover: marine cargo insurance, land cargo insurance, air cargo insurance, and postal insurance. The international trade transportation insurance program sometimes involves the use of two or more modes of transportation throughout the entire transportation process of a batch of goods. In this case, the main mode of transportation during the entire transportation process is often used to determine the type of international trade transportation insurance to be insured.
